コード例 #1
0
        private void frmAyarlar_Load(object sender, EventArgs e)
        {
            cPersoneller      p     = new cPersoneller();
            cPersonelGorevler g     = new cPersonelGorevler();
            string            gorev = g.PersonelGorevTanim(cGenel.personelId);

            if (gorev == "Müdür")
            {
                p.PersonelleriGetir(cmbPersonelAd);
                g.PersonelGorevGetir(cmbGorev);
                p.PersonelBilgileriGetirFormIdLv(lvPersoneller);
                btnYeni.Enabled         = true;
                btnSil.Enabled          = false;
                btnDegis.Enabled        = false;
                btnEkle.Enabled         = false;
                groupBox1.Visible       = true;
                groupBox2.Visible       = true;
                groupBox3.Visible       = false;
                groupBox4.Visible       = true;
                txtSifre.ReadOnly       = true;
                txtSifreTekrar.ReadOnly = true;
                bilgi.Text = p.PersonelBilgisiGetirİsim(cGenel.personelId);
            }
            else
            {
                groupBox1.Visible = false;
                groupBox2.Visible = false;
                groupBox3.Visible = true;
                groupBox4.Visible = false;
                bilgi.Text        = p.PersonelBilgisiGetirİsim(cGenel.personelId);
            }
        }
コード例 #2
0
 private void btnEkle_Click(object sender, EventArgs e)
 {
     if (txtAd.Text.Trim() != "" & txtSoyad.Text.Trim() != "" & txtSifre.Text.Trim() != "" & txtSifreTekrar.Text.Trim() != "" & txtGörevId.Text.Trim() != "")
     {
         if (txtSifre.Text.Trim() == txtSifreTekrar.Text.Trim())
         {
             cPersoneller c = new cPersoneller();
             c.PersonelAd1     = txtAd.Text.Trim();
             c.PersonelSoyad1  = txtSoyad.Text.Trim();
             c.PersonelParola1 = txtSifre.Text.Trim();
             c.GorevId1        = Convert.ToInt32(txtGörevId.Text);
             bool sonuc = c.PersonelEkle(c);
             if (sonuc)
             {
                 MessageBox.Show("Personel Ekleme başarılı");
                 c.PersonelBilgileriGetirFormIdLv(lvPersoneller);
             }
             else
             {
                 MessageBox.Show("Personel ekleme başarısız");
             }
         }
         else
         {
             MessageBox.Show("Şifreler aynı değil");
         }
     }
     else
     {
         MessageBox.Show("boş alan bırakma");
     }
 }
コード例 #3
0
 private void btnDegis_Click(object sender, EventArgs e)
 {
     if (lvPersoneller.SelectedItems.Count > 0)
     {
         if (txtAd.Text.Trim() != "" && txtSoyad.Text.Trim() != "" && txtSifre.Text.Trim() != "" && txtSifreTekrar.Text.Trim() != "" && txtGörevId.Text.Trim() != "")
         {
             if (txtSifre.Text.Trim() == txtSifreTekrar.Text.Trim())
             {
                 cPersoneller c = new cPersoneller();
                 c.PersonelAd1     = txtAd.Text.Trim();
                 c.PersonelSoyad1  = txtSoyad.Text.Trim();
                 c.PersonelParola1 = txtSifre.Text.Trim();
                 c.GorevId1        = Convert.ToInt32(txtGörevId.Text);
                 bool sonuc = c.PersonelGuncelle(c, Convert.ToInt32(txPersonelId.Text));
                 if (sonuc)
                 {
                     MessageBox.Show("Personel güncelleme başarılı");
                     c.PersonelBilgileriGetirFormIdLv(lvPersoneller);
                 }
                 else
                 {
                     MessageBox.Show("Personel güncelleme başarısız");
                 }
             }
             else
             {
                 MessageBox.Show("Şifreler aynı değil");
             }
         }
     }
     else
     {
         MessageBox.Show("Güncellenecek personeli seçin");
     }
 }
コード例 #4
0
 private void btnSil_Click(object sender, EventArgs e)
 {
     if (lvPersoneller.SelectedItems.Count > 0)
     {
         if (MessageBox.Show("Silmek istediğinizden eminmisiniz", "Uyarı", MessageBoxButtons.YesNo, MessageBoxIcon.Warning) == DialogResult.Yes)
         {
             cPersoneller c     = new cPersoneller();
             bool         sonuc = c.PersonelSil(Convert.ToInt32(lvPersoneller.SelectedItems[0].Text));
             if (sonuc)
             {
                 MessageBox.Show("silme başarılı");
                 c.PersonelBilgileriGetirFormIdLv(lvPersoneller);
             }
             else
             {
                 MessageBox.Show("Kayıt silinemedi");
             }
         }
         else
         {
             MessageBox.Show("Silinecek kaydı seç");
         }
     }
 }